How Much Does a Grader Classifier Inspector make?

Grader Classifier Inspector made a median salary around $42,288 in March, 2024. The best-paid 25 percent made $47,743 probably that year, while the lowest-paid 25 percent made around $38,090.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Best-Paying States for Grader Classifier Inspector

The states and districts that pay Grader Classifier Inspector the highest salary are District of Columbia (around $47,066) , California (around $46,643) , New Jersey (around $46,347) , Alaska (around $46,051) , and Massachusetts (around $46,009) .
District of Columbia $47,066
California $46,643
New Jersey $46,347
Alaska $46,051
Massachusetts $46,009

Log Grader and Scaler - Average Salary $46,680
Log Grader and Scaler grades logs in a sorting yard, millpond, or log deck according to industry or company standards. May require a high school diploma or its equivalent and 2-4 years of experience in the field or in a related area. Being a Log Grader and Scaler is familiar with standard concepts, practices, and procedures within a particular field. Relies on limited exper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Additionally, Log Grader and Scaler performs a variety of tasks. Works under general supervision. A certain degree of creativity and latitude is required. Typically reports to a supervisor/manager.
Grader Operator - Average Salary $48,803
The Grader Operator prepares land for constructing roads and buildings. Operates a specially equipped tractor to gouge out, level, and distribute earth. Being a Grader Operator may have to complete an apprenticeship and/or formal training in area of specialty with 2-4 years of experience in the field or in a related area. May require a high school diploma or its equivalent. In addition, Grader Operator is familiar with standard concepts, practices, and procedures within a particular field. Relies on limited exper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Performs a variety of tasks. Works under general supervision. A certain degree of creativity and latitude is required. Typically reports to a supervisor/manager.
